Allianz AG, (; IPA pronunciation: *) is a large financial service provider headquartered in Munich, Germany. By revenue it is the largest FSP in the world, however it is much farther down on profit.
Core and focus is on the insurance business. With $130 billion of revenue during 2004 Allianz is by far the biggest insurance company in Germany.
Allianz AG was founded in Berlin in 1880 and moved its headquarters to Munich in 1949. In 2001, Allianz acquired Dresdner Bank, a large German bank. It operates worldwide under the name Allianz Group. The Allianz became the provider for the Allianz Arena in Munich for 30 years in the 2000s.

Allianz operate a general insurance business in Australia through Allianz Australia Insurance Limited (ABN 15 000 122 850, AFS Licence No. 234708)
Allianz owns British insurance company Cornhill Insurance plc now renamed Allianz Cornhill Insurance plc.
